Leaking Dishwashing machine


This is possibly the most everyday dishwashing machine issue, and also the bright side is that it is very easy to identify. Leaks happen because of a number of factors, and also the leakages can bungle your kitchen. Typical root causes of dishwashing machine leakages consist of;
  • Inappropriate pipeline link: If the pipelines at the rear of your machine are not firmly dealt with or if they are worn out, it can cause leaks.

  • Improper dish stacking: Always ensure that you do not overstack the tray and that you arrange the dishes properly

  • Too much detergent: Placing ample cleaning agent can additionally create a leakage. Make sure that you place simply enough for your meals as well as not much more.

  • Rust: It could also be an outcome of some corrosion or deterioration of your maker. In this situation, it is better to change the dish washer.

  • Door Seals: Examine if the door seals are still undamaged as well as securely fastened. If the seals are not ready, maybe a substantial root cause of leaks.

  • Does not clean properly

  • If your recipes and also flatwares come out of the dishwasher and also still look unclean or dirty, your spray arms may be a problem. In many cases, the spray arms can obtain blocked, and it will call for a fast clean or a replacement to function successfully again.

    Inability to Drain pipes


    Often you may see a big amount of water left in your bathtub after a laundry. That is most likely a drainage trouble. You can either inspect the drain tube for damages or blockages. When doubtful, call a professional to have it examined as well as fixed.
  • Bad-Smelling Dish washer

  • This is one more common dish washer problem, and also it is generally caused by food particles or grease sticking around in the maker. In this case, try to find these particles, take them out and also do the meals with no meals inside the maker. Wash the filter extensively. That will assist remove the poor scent. Guarantee that you remove every food bit from your dishes before moving it to the device in the future.

    My Dishes Are Still Dirty


    This is at the top of a list for a reason. Dirty dishes are common and frustrating. Easy fixes first; check if your dishwasher has a manual filter and make sure that it’s clean and clear of debris. Then, as you load your dishwasher, make sure that the spray arms can rotate freely, spraying water throughout the drum. If they’re blocked or obstructed, you won’t be getting optimal cleaning performance. If the problem continues, check if your spray arms are clean and moving freely as grease and food particles can prevent them from spinning.



    Also, stop pre-rinsing your dishes! Modern dishwashers use sensors to determine the soil level of the dishes. If you rinse them off too much, your dishwasher may select a shorter cycle than is necessary. Modern detergents also use enzymes that activate when they come in contact with food particles. If you remove the particles, your detergent will be less effective too.


    My Dishes Aren’t Drying


    The easiest fixes here are to add Rinse Aid to your dishwasher when you start the load to assist drying, and to make sure you don’t stack plastic against plastic or other hard to dry materials. It’s also a good idea to open the dishwasher door when the cycle is complete to release steam and prevent condensation from settling on your dishes (some higher-end machines even open automatically). If your dishwasher has a heating element, you may have to check if it is working properly. Check also the fan if your dishwasher has a stainless steel tub that uses blown radiant heat to dry.


    My Dishwasher Smells Bad


    If your dishwasher smells bad, make sure your filter and screens are cleaned of any grime and food residue. Check the spray arms and gasket on the door to make sure there’s no grease or food waste there as well. If you’ve done that, then it may just be time to sanitize the drum. Place a small bowl with vinegar in the upper basket of your empty dishwasher and run the sanitize cycle (or the hottest cycle you’ve got) to blast away bad odours.


    My Dishwasher Won’t Start


    If your dishwasher won’t start there’s often an electrical problem, and if you’re lucky that means there’s a very easy fix. Ask yourself, have I tried turning it off and on? If not, then do that. If it’s still not working, try unplugging and re-plugging in the machine and double-check your breaker to make sure power is feeding the unit. If it’s a mechanical problem, then it may be that your door isn’t latching properly and a simple realignment will get things sorted out.


    My Dishwasher Won’t Fill


    If possible, check your intake valves and make sure that the screen is clear and that there’s no blockage obstructing water flow. If that’s not it, then the float and/or float switch located at the bottom of the drum could be the problem. Make sure that the electrical connections are intact and that the mechanism hasn’t been damaged or blocked in any way.
